Hi pilot,

I've been a year flying mavic pro, but never satisfied with footage quality. they failed to get better focus.


thought.??
 
This looks like footage from the low quality mobile device cache, not the original footage from the SD card.
 
What settings are you using ?
 
It looks like something is on the lens. The top of the frame looks cloudy. Are you flying with the gimbal protector dome on? Any filters? Is the lens clean?

Don’t bother with downloading the footage through the app - the only way to get the true quality is to put the SD card into your computer.

And as lannes said, there’s almost no reason to not select 4K as the quality.

Make sure you tap to focus once you’re in the air so that your shot is clear. You may need to invest in some ND filters to get the exposure and colour balanced right

my normal setting is 4k/24fps and landscape, color = vivid, video format = mov, PAL, AWB.

I use Powerdirector 16 for editing, on a i7 2.6ghz with 32gb ram using windows 10 - 64bit, with a Nvidia Titan X Pascal GPU
 
Normally I do 4K/24fps with colour=D-Cinelike , MOV format, and white balance dependant on the weather.

I edit this all on a Core i5 MacBook Pro
 
little bit improvement, with ND-32, +1,0,0. stil d-cinelake. the final ev value was -1.


any thought for improvement.?

thank
 
try your sharpness at -1 not plus 1, i read that possitive sharpness adds noise reduction which may look soft, u can add sharpness in post, i use -1 for photos with good results
